Poddar Group of Institutions
Poddar Group of Institutions

Neural Networks in Artificial Intelligence

Neural Networks in Artificial Intelligence

In today’s rapidly advancing digital world, artificial intelligence (AI) has emerged as a central force behind modern innovation, automation, and data-driven decision-making. At the core of many AI systems are neural networks, which are computational models inspired by the structure and functioning of the human brain. These networks can identify patterns, process large amounts of data, and make intelligent predictions with impressive accuracy. They have transformed industries by powering technologies such as facial recognition, self-driving cars, virtual assistants, and healthcare diagnostics. Understanding how neural networks work is essential for students preparing for careers in computer science and emerging technologies. Poddar International College, one of the top BCA colleges in Jaipur, known for its forward-thinking approach to technology education, emphasizes the study of neural networks to equip learners with the skills needed for the future of AI-driven innovation.

What Are Neural Networks?

Neural networks are computer systems designed to simulate how the human brain analyzes and processes information. A BCA or MCA course in Jaipur at Poddar International College helps students learn that neural networks consist of interconnected nodes called neurons, which work together to identify patterns and learn from data.

Each neural network typically has three layers:

1. Input Layer–Receives data (images, text, numbers, etc.).

2. Hidden Layers–Perform complex calculations and extract patterns.

3. Output Layer–Produces the result (prediction, classification, etc.).

Just like humans learn from experience, neural networks improve their accuracy by adjusting internal parameters every time they are trained with new data.

How Neural Networks Work

Here is how the neural networks work in a system:

1. Data enters the network as inputs.

2. Each neuron processes the data and passes a signal to the next neuron.

3. The network assigns “weights” to connections, representing importance.

4. The system compares the output with the correct answer.

5. Errors are corrected using a method called backpropagation.

6. After many iterations, the network “learns” to produce accurate results.

This ability to learn from experience makes neural networks powerful tools for modern AI systems.

Types of Neural Networks

Let us now discuss the types of neural networks. These are often discussed at the top-ranked BCA college in Jaipur, which helps students learn about the kinds of networks.

1. Feedforward Neural Networks (FNN)

  • The simplest type is where data flows in one direction.
  • Used for basic prediction and classification tasks.

Example: Predicting student exam scores based on study hours.

2. Convolutional Neural Networks (CNN)

  • Used mainly for image and video processing.
  • Detect patterns like edges, colors, and shapes.

Real-World Example:

The face unlock system on smartphones uses CNNs to recognize your face.

3. Recurrent Neural Networks (RNN)

  • Designed for sequence-based data like text, speech, or time series.
  • Have memories of past inputs.

Real-World Example:

Google Translate uses RNN models to understand languages.

4. Deep Neural Networks (DNN)

  • It contains many hidden layers.
  • Used for solving highly complex problems.

Real-World Example:

Self-driving cars use DNNs to identify road signs, obstacles, and pedestrians.

Real-World Applications of Neural Networks

Here are some real-world applications of neural networks:

1. Healthcare

Neural networks analyze X-rays, detect tumors, and assist doctors in diagnosing diseases with high accuracy.

2. Finance

Banks use them for fraud detection, loan risk prediction, and stock market forecasting.

3. E-commerce

Amazon and Flipkart use neural networks to recommend products by analyzing user behavior.

4. Transportation

Autonomous vehicles rely on neural networks for object detection and decision-making.

5. Social Media

Platforms like Instagram and TikTok use neural networks for content recommendation and face recognition filters.

6. Agriculture

They help in crop disease detection, weather forecasting, and yield prediction.

Benefits of Neural Networks

Let us now discuss the benefits of neural networks:

1. Handles Complex Data

Neural networks can process images, audio, videos, and textual data better than traditional algorithms.

2. Learns Automatically

They improve performance over time, just like humans learn from experience.

3. High Accuracy

Neural networks deliver excellent results in tasks like image recognition, language translation, and prediction.

4. Adaptability

They can adjust to new data and changing environments.

5. Scalability

Neural networks can be expanded to handle massive datasets used in industries today.

Challenges of Neural Networks

Here are the challenges of neural networks that students pursuing a BCA course in Jaipur must know about:

1. Requires Large Data

Neural networks need thousands or millions of samples to learn effectively.

2. High Computational Power

Powerful GPUs or cloud systems are often needed for training.

3. Black Box Problem

It is difficult to understand exactly how the network makes decisions.

4. Long Training Time

Deep networks can take hours or even days to train.

5. Risk of Overfitting

The model may memorize the training data instead of learning patterns, reducing accuracy.

Future of Neural Networks

Neural networks are evolving rapidly with new techniques like:

  • Generative AI
  • Transformer models
  • Reinforcement learning
  • Neuromorphic computing

These advancements will make AI systems more intelligent, efficient, and human-like.

Conclusion

Neural networks have become the foundation of modern artificial intelligence, enabling machines to see, hear, speak, and make decisions with incredible accuracy. Their impact spans across industries, making them essential for the future of technology and innovation. As digital transformation accelerates globally, knowledge of neural networks has become a crucial skill for students and professionals alike. Poddar International College, the leading IT college in Jaipur, continues to promote advanced learning in AI, preparing learners to contribute effectively to emerging technological landscapes. By understanding neural networks and their applications, students gain the foundation needed to excel in AI-driven careers and shape the future of intelligent technology.